Manufacturing Engineer

Spectrum Plastics Group
Minneapolis, MN Full Time
POSTED ON 4/23/2026
AVAILABLE BEFORE 6/23/2026

SUMMARY:

Provide manufacturing engineering and technical support to other Engineering teams while working cross-functionally with Quality, Tooling Engineers, Maintenance, Process Engineers and Project Engineers as well as support the Production teams to support daily production and ensure achievement of safety, quality, on-time delivery, and cost objectives.

 

KEY ACCOUNTABILITIES:

  • Actively promote and drive a culture of safety within Spectrum Plastics.
  • Provide daily technical support to production to achieve department goals for safety, quality, on-time delivery, scrap, efficiency, and cost improvements.
  • Drive continuous improvement using Lean Manufacturing methodologies to improve these same metrics.
  • Troubleshoot manufacturing processes and equipment and perform root cause analyses.
  • Develop and improve manufacturing processes for new product introductions.
  • Write and train production personnel on work instructions and procedures.

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Solve problems on the factory floor and act as the primary technical resource to resolve production issues after they have been escalated through the factory.
  • Perform troubleshooting, root cause analysis activities, and implementation of long-term solutions to prevent re-occurrence.
  • Develop and implement process improvements.
  • Generate and keep all manufacturing documentation up-to-date (BOM’s, specification changes, ECO’s, reports, print revisions, fixturing, protocols, etc.).
  • Lead formal root cause investigations and implement resulting corrective actions in a timely manner and confirm effectiveness through statistical analysis.
  • Interface with suppliers as required for incoming components, outsourced services, and new process equipment.
  • Write and revise protocols and reports, both internally and externally, for validation.
  • Complete process FMEA’s as required and implement and review process controls.
  • Contribute as a member of Material Review Board.
  • Perform all other duties and responsibilities, as assigned.
Qualifications:

QUALIFICATIONS, EXPERIENCE, SKILLS, EDUCATION AND TRAINING:

  • Bachelor’s Degree in Engineering (B.S.)
  • Minimum 3 years of Manufacturing Engineer experience in plastics injection molding.
  • Excellent problem-solving skills to identify, gather, and analyze information develop solutions and resolve problems in a timely manner.
  • High level of accountability. Aligned with our policy of Promises Made – Promises Kept.
  • Ability to manage multiple projects and responsibilities simultaneously.
  • Highly collaborative with strong written and verbal communication skills.
  • Support the factory with a superior level of customer service and responsiveness.
  • Able to work in a fast-paced, team environment.
  • A background or working knowledge of polymers and injection molding is highly preferred.
  • Experience in a regulated industry and familiarity with the requirements for medical device manufacturing.
  • Strong working knowledge of Microsoft Office software.
  • Minitab experience highly preferred.
  • CAD experience.

Salary : $80,000 - $90,000
